manojOoh, MINUS.... Can you not use a NOT EXISTS in this case, could have a big effect on the execution plan?
Something like this perhaps?
SELECT f_name||' '||l_name,
stundent_id
FROM class_record a,
s_per_det b
WHERE a.student_id = b.student_id
AND a.class_id = :P1_CLASS_ID
AND a.section = :P1_SECTION
AND NOT EXISTS(SELECT 'X'
FROM student_type_details c
WHERE a.student_id = c.student_id
AND c.class_id = :P1_CLASS_ID
AND c.section = :P1_SECTION)Cheers

What is different between exporting and returning value in method of a class. if created an object inside the method and exporting it, it means I have a reference to that object inside program. If I use returning value, it means I have a copy of object created inside the method, but the object inside method is destroyed after it ends. Do I understand correctly? if so what do u prefer exporting or returning value? thanks!
Hello Anthony
The major difference is that you can have multiple EXPORTING parameters yet only a single RETURNING parameter. In addition, if you have a RETURNING parameter you cannot have EXPORTING parameters simultaneously.
Defining methods with a single RETURNING parameter is more Java-like than having multiple EXPORTING parameters.
Whenever possible and sensible I prefer RETURNING parameters over EXPORTING parameters because they allow to use the function method call, e.g.:
go_msglist = cf_reca_messagelist_create( ).

I'm sure there is a clever way to cascade functions to avoid adding an auxiliary column in your practice table, but to me it wouldn't be worth the aggravation. I would add a column that concatenates Columns A & B, AWG & mils. This column can be anywhere and would be Hidden. Let's say your new column is Column N.
In Column N, fill the body rows with:
=A&"-"&B
As good Numbers programming form would indicate, let's name the Practice Table Practices and only put the practices in that table. In another table where you do the lookup, let's call it Program, we will have the calculation/lookup.
Based on your example, I'd guess that AWG may be in Column D and mils in Column E of your Program table, and the Soak lookup in Column F. If I'm wrong, adjust the column id.
In Column F, write:
=OFFSET(Practices::I$1,MATCH(D&"-"&E, Practices::N,0)−1, 0)
The hyphen in the concatenated representation of the combination of AWG and mils is just tp make it more readable.
As I'm sure you know, you could use other approaches, but since I had you put your aux column at the end of your Practices table, OFFSET with MATCH is a clean approach. INDEX could be used too.

Thank you very much!Lets take this slow and easy. First of all, you need to learn how to format your code for readability. Read and take to heart
{color:0000ff}http://java.sun.com/docs/codeconv/html/CodeConvTOC.doc.html{color}
Now as to your first exercise, most of it is OK but not this: public boolean wasModified()
if (val == y && modified == true)
return true;
y being a parmeter to the setValue method exists only within the scope of that method. And why would you want to test that anyways? If modified evaluates to true, that's all you need to know that the value has been modified. So you could have public boolean wasModified()
if (modified == true)
return true;
}But even that is unnecessarily verbose, as the if condition evaluates to true, and the same is returned. So in the final analysis, all you need is public boolean wasModified()
return modified;
}And a public class has to be declared in a file named for the class, yes.
As for your second assignment, NO you cannot "return" two variables fom a method. return means just that: when the return statement is encountered, control returns to the calling routine. That's why the compiler is complaining that the statement following the (first) return statement is unreachable.
Do you know how to string Strings together? (it's called concatenation.) And how to represent a newline in a String literal?
